SeaMonkey 2.0a3 Changelog (Target Milestone)
New Features and Fixes
Browser
- non-ASCII characters should be decoded in the urlbar (like in FF3) (Bug 425480)
- Port Bug 448976 (turn the Session Restore prompt into an error page) to SeaMonkey (Bug 459550)
- Remove tabbbrowser-tab binding in tabbrowser.xml (Bug 467618)
- Switch matchOnlyTyped to restrict.typed "~" (default.behavior + 32) (Bug 473734)
- Cleanup SeaMonkey sessionstore code a bit. (Bug 478470)
- Browser tests suite leaks after Session Restore feature landing (Bug 478506)
- aWindow.getBrowser is not a function when calling nsSessionStore:getWindowState() (Bug 478768)
MailNews
- Access key conflicts in "Server Settings" pane (Bug 281642)
- Missing accesskeys in the account wizard. (Bug 322246)
- Various accesskeys missing in the main interface and prefs. (Bug 322247)
- SeaMonkey's statusbar progress uses different mechanism from Thunderbird's (Bug 458533)
- Space shouldn't scroll the page if something is focused in it (Bug 465721)
- (Back-)Port |Bug 223943 - expand "mailnews.headers.showUserAgent" to include x-newsreader| to SeaMonkey (Bug 467192)
- Combine messagePaneContext and threadPaneContext (Bug 469498)
- Port |Bug 291341 - switching from drafts folder to saved search folder does not remove "Edit Draft..." button| to SeaMonkey (Bug 472386)
- Junk controls don't work in standalone message window (Bug 475200)
- Make File/Compact Folders compact all folders of the selected folder's account (Bug 477394)
General
- Autosave URIs of open windows and tabs for later restoration in event of crash (session restore) (Bug 36810)
- Sidebar's add/manage buttons opens a new window rather than bring existing one to front (Bug 203400)
- Missing accesskeys in Bookmark Manager. (Bug 322239)
- Various pref panel items missing accesskeys. (Bug 322240)
- use places for SeaMonkey history (Bug 382187)
- Move to LoginManager and remove wallet from SeaMonkey (Bug 390025)
- Leak EM-related stuff after bug 382963 (Bug 391318)
- Implement Customizable Toolbars in Navigator (Bug 394288)
- Sidebar in Help Viewer is not collapsible (Bug 406552)
- Remove xpfe/components/history from trunk (Bug 448729)
- Fishcam really dead now (Bug 454847)
- Polish toEM() and also toOpenWindowByType() should support more parameters. (Bug 458512)
- Clean up formatting.css (Bug 459668)
- Make use of emptytext attribute in search textboxes (Bug 460694)
- Bookmark groups are not showing in bookmarks menu (Bug 461167)
- Get rid of Components.returnCode use in suite/ (Bug 467006)
- Add preferences options for popup and missing plugin infobars (Bug 467174)
- Cannot hide search bar in bookmark manager (Bug 467570)
- Document new UI from |Bug 467174 - [RFE] Add preferences options for popup and missing plugin infobars| (Bug 467674)
- Recreate the SeaMonkey throbber as APNG (Bug 468103)
- Add UI prefs for new places history functionality (Bug 468326)
- Places for SeaMonkey history is missing Windows packaging (Bug 468381)
- Reimplement grouping in the main history window (Bug 468809)
- Provide tests for Bug 463504 (Bug 469112)
- Display notification bar checkbox enabled even if pref is set to not block popups (Bug 469338)
- Plugin notification pref needs to get out of the Enable Plugins for MailNews groupbox (Bug 469346)
- Tidy up CSS after Bug 428216 (Bug 470417)
- Broken/missing icons in Help (Bug 470683)
- Customizable Toolbars in Navigator (Part 2) (Bug 471372)
- Update SeaMonkey's copyright strings to 2009 (Bug 471742)
- Use .trim*() in SeaMonkey (Bug 471845)
- Need to mention notification bar in one more place in cs_priv_prefs_popup.xhtml (Bug 472716)
- Updater should use brand name string and not hardcode Seamonkey (Bug 472796)
- spelling error in help-index1.rdf (Bug 473024)
- Port |Bug 404414 - Add keyboard shortcut to open Error Console| to SeaMonkey (Bug 473665)
- test_notifications.html and test_prompt.html mochitests fail: "notifyBox is undefined" (Bug 474159)
- Fix incorrectly defined accesskey in Customisable toolbars context menu (Bug 475323)
- atEndOfSession define in cookieAcceptDialog.properties should be capitalize (SeaMonkey port) (Bug 475385)
- Favicon not limited to 16x16 in Bookmarks sidebar and Bookmark Manager (Bug 476740)
- Error: prefpane.paneload: loadSubScript("chrome://communicator/content/pref/pref-passwords.js") failed (Bug 477369)
- Sort Folder dialog lacks accesskeys (Bug 478025)
- Some Help buttons (e.g. in Message Filters dialog) bring up empty Help window (Help file not found) (Bug 478913)
- tracking bug for build and release of SeaMonkey 2.0 Alpha 3 (Bug 479118)
Windows
- test_idcheck.xul : preferences.xul leaks (Bug 458486)
- Setting SeaMonkey as default news application does not work (Bug 468379)
- Add-On Manager shows "Restart SeaMonkey to complete your changes" without any change (Bug 472646)
- ${BrandFullName} needs to be quoted in shared.nsh (Bug 475889)
- Can't drop between two folders on Personal Toolbar anymore (Bug 476237)
- Remove installer code that adds unused registry key values (Bug 477208)
- nsWindowsShellService::SetDefaultClientVista is not used and can be removed (Bug 477355)
Linux
- obsolete l10n-files in tinderbox builds but not in nightlies (Bug 475332)
Special Operating Systems
- macOS: In OSX The customizeToolbars window should be in a <panel> popup. (Bug 406780)
- macOS: Need toolbar borders in SeaMonkey (Bug 470037)
- macOS: Make customizable menubars work without regressing OSX (Bug 475920)
Compiling
- Add ro (Romanian) to suite/locales/all-locales (Bug 453100)
- [ja] Add Japanese locale (ja/ja-JP-mac) to Seamonkey/Chatzilla/Venkman all-locales file (Bug 467597)
- add gl to suite/locales/all-locales file (Bug 467977)
- Add pl to Venkman all-locales (Bug 470625)
- Add pt-BR to Chatzilla all-locales (Bug 471010)
- Remove extra 'index.cgi/' part in links on Tinderbox waterfall (Bug 472289)
- Venkman and ChatZilla packaging in L10n builds busted (Bug 473921)
- Add es-AR to all-locales (Bug 475851)